About CooperSurgical:
CooperSurgical is a leading fertility and womens healthcare company dedicated to putting time on the side of women babies and families at the healthcare moments that matter most in life. CooperSurgical is at the forefront of delivering innovative assisted reproductive technology and genomic solutions that enhance the work of ART professionals to the benefit of families. We currently offer over 600 clinically relevant medical devices to womens healthcare providers including testing and treatment options.
CooperSurgical is a wholly-owned subsidiary of CooperCompanies (Nasdaq: COO). CooperSurgical headquartered in Trumbull CT produces and markets a wide array of products and services for use by womens health care clinicians. More information can be found at.

Scope:
The Manufacturing Engineer I is responsible for optimizing manufacturing processes and ensuring the production of high-quality medical devices. The Manufacturing Engineer I will primarily contribute to sustaining activities as well as continuous improvement initiatives that reduce costs and increase the quality of CooperSurgicals manufacturing processes. The Manufacturing Engineer I is expected to have strong partnerships with the production quality product engineering and regulatory departments.
Job Summary:
The Manufacturing Engineer I at CooperSurgical is responsible for driving manufacturing excellence and optimizing production processes for our medical device and fertility products. The Manufacturing Engineer I plays a critical role in implementing lean principles improving process efficiency and fostering a culture of continuous improvement.
